Hotel rates across Japan have climbed to record highs, driven by a sharp increase in tourists from the United States and Europe, according to a Nikkei Asia report. This rise has helped offset a notable decline in visitors from China, reshaping the country’s inbound tourism landscape. The trend highlights shifting global travel patterns and the impact of currency fluctuations.

Recent data from the Nikkei Asia report indicates that average hotel rates in Japan have reached historical peaks, buoyed by strong demand from US and European travelers. The weaker yen has made Japan a more affordable destination for Western tourists, leading to higher occupancy and room prices. Concurrently, the number of Chinese visitors has fallen, partly due to lingering travel restrictions and economic factors in China. The report suggests that hotel operators are now benefiting from a more diversified tourist base, reducing reliance on a single source market. Major cities like Tokyo, Kyoto, and Osaka have seen particularly pronounced rate increases. The trend is also supported by improved air connectivity and renewed marketing efforts targeting long-haul travelers. While specific rate percentages were not disclosed in the summary, industry observers note that the surge reflects a broader recovery in global travel demand.

Key takeaways from this development include a potential structural shift in Japan’s tourism industry. The reduced dependence on Chinese tourists may lower vulnerability to policy changes or economic slowdowns in China. However, the decline in Chinese arrivals could also signal deeper issues, such as trade tensions or weaker consumer sentiment in Asia. For Japan’s hospitality sector, the ability to attract higher-spending US and European visitors may support revenue growth in the near term. Smaller regional hotels and ryokans (traditional inns) could also benefit if the trend expands beyond major cities. The yen’s current weakness acts as a tailwind, but any future appreciation might dampen demand from Western markets. Additionally, the shift places greater emphasis on sustainable tourism practices to manage overcrowding in popular destinations.

From an investment perspective, the changing composition of Japan’s inbound tourism could influence profitability for hotel operators and related businesses. Hotel real estate investment trusts (REITs) and hospitality firms may see continued upward pressure on room rates if US and European travel demand remains robust. However, caution is warranted as the situation is fluid: any escalation in geopolitical tensions or a reversal in currency trends could reduce travel flows. The broader implication is that Japan’s tourism recovery is becoming more balanced across source markets, which may enhance long-term stability. Investors should monitor upcoming quarterly reports from major hotel chains and tourism agencies for further confirmation of these patterns. The Nikkei report underscores that market dynamics are evolving, and no single factor guarantees sustained growth.
